Perfect Man: Top 10 Movies

1. Akira – (the movie is still beyond it’s time, a supreme source of inspiration and creativity. Bottom line an epic masterpiece!)

2. They Live – (one of the greatest fight scenes of all time between Keith David and WWF legend Rody Piper is just icing on this cake in a classic sci-fi/ B-movie that is a cautionary tale on the evils of capitalism. It resonates today just as it did in the Regan era.)

3. Revolver – Guy Ritchie’s finest movie was his most slept on. I’ve never seen a action/ gangster film with so much depth.

4. Bamboozled - This Movie was the most brilliant satire since the Network, This is Spike Lee’s magnum opus in my opinion exploring the exploitation and racism in the media and how it goes hand in hand with capitalism.

5. Ghost Dog – The spiritual, gangster, hip-hop, samurai, western movie…all blended together seamlessly. This is also what made RZA a musical score genius.

6. The Matrix – Aside from the amazing special effects and the action….the plot had to be the best in terms of the man vs. machine plotline. Forget the other two movies.

7. TC2000 – The greatest kung-fu B-Movie of all-time!!!!

8. Hav Plenty – The best love story movie I’ve seen. Hilarious look at love and sex but unlike most movies it was easy to relate to. Its a shame it was so underrated.

9. Commandante – A conversation between Oliver Stone and Fidel Castro is so refreshing in the era of so many contrived interviews this one flows very easily. A wonderfully executed documentary which goes into detail on events rarely discussed such as the Cuban Revolution or the Bay of Pigs.

10. Enter The Dragon – Bruce Lee and Jim Kelly, it can’t get any better than that….well maybe, in the original script jim kelly lived and john saxson died…even still this movie changed the face of martial art cinema and still stands the test of time as an all-time great.
